10.7.1.6 show ipv6 pimsm rp mapping

Use this command to display all group-to-RP mappings of which the router is a aware (either configured
or learned from the bootstrap router (BSR)). If no RP is specified, all active RPs are displayed.

Syntax

show ipv6 pimsm rp mapping [rp address]

Default Setting

None

Command Mode

Privileged Exec

User Exec

Display Message

RP Address: This field displays the IP address of the RP.

Type: Indicates the mechanism (BSR or static) by which the RP was selected.

10.7.2.1 ipv6 pimsm

This command sets administrative mode of PIM-SM multicast routing across the router to enabled. MLD
must be enabled before PIM-SM can be enabled.

Syntax

ipv6 pimsm
no ipv6 pimsm
